Cyrea exclamationis is a species of beetle of the family Coccinellidae. It is found in Brazil.
Description
Adults reach a length of about 1.9-2.7 mm. They have a yellow body. The pronotum is black with yellow borders. The elytron is black with two yellow spots.[1]
